HYBE x Geffen Records Announce Contestants for Forthcoming Global Girl Group | Billboard News

Class is finally in session for ‘The Debut: Dream Academy.’ HYBE and Geffen Records revealed Monday evening (Aug. 28) the 20 talented contestants from around the world who will be competing for a spot in the first-ever HYBE x Geffen Records global girl group.

Super labels Geffen and HYBE have teamed up to bring you a global group of epic proportions. HYBE’s Bang Si-hyuk and Geffen CEO John Janick kicked off the announcement of their joint venture. And yesterday I hosted a panel discussion with the team behind ‘The Debut: Dream Academy,’ a training and development program looking to form a girl group comprised of young women from around the world.

Tom March
There’s going to be fans right from the beginning in multiple countries all around the world helping us pick the artists to form the group.

Tetris Kelly
The event introduced us to the 20 young women from around the world competing for a spot in the girl group being formed at the end of the program. Starting on September 1, you’ll see the women from Korea, Japan, Brazil, Argentina, the US and so many more countries show their skills on YouTube.

Tetris Kelly
Over the span of 12 weeks, we’ll see the girls go through the audition process and fans will be able to vote via TikTok and Weverse who they want to ultimately end up in the group. The results of the audition process will be announced live on November 17. Not only that, they’re capturing the entire process to air in a docuseries on Netflix next year. Who is your initial bias? Jon Batiste Reveals His Favorite New Orleans Slang | Billboard

Jon Batiste reveals his favorite New Orleans slang to Billboard.

Jon Batiste:
Hello, it’s Jon Batiste and this is my Favorite Slang from New Orleans.

“Wuzham, wodie?” “Wuzham?” is “What’s happening?” Was happening … wuz happenin … wuzham. You see the progression? Wuzham. Wuzham, wod.

Another one you might hear me say is, “Where y’at?” “Where are you at?” It’s, like, philosophical too. It’s like, “Where you at?” Like, not just “Where are you?” But just, like, “Where y’at?”

Ohhhh, this is like, it’s not really slang, but people say “Laissez les bons temps rouler.” People say it in New Orleans sometimes. Means “Let the good times roll.”

That is some of my favorite New Orleans favorite slang. Favorite ever!

Here Are 5 Things You Don’t Know About Tim McGraw | Billboard

Tim McGraw reveals five things you didn’t know about him to Billboard.

Tim McGraw:
Hi! I’m Tim McGraw, and here are five things you may not know about me.

I love potting flowers around my house. I spend each spring and each fall with all these terra-cotta pots we have around the house and I go to the plant nursery and buy all these flowers, and I plant all of them and spend the whole day doing it. It’s therapy. I love doing that.

And secondly, I’m a pilot. So I don’t know how many people know that.

Thirdly, one of my favorite things in the world to do is spear fish. Any chance I get to spear fish, I spear fish and I do it free dive with an old-fashioned pole spear. I haven’t been able to do it in a while, but that’s right at the top of my list and one of my favorite things to do.

I’m a crier. I cry at, like, bad commercials. I cry. I cry if I have to get up and speak and say something about anything or about talking about my kids or my wife. I’ll start crying. So I’m a I’m an easy crier.

Yacht rock. I am a huge yacht rock fan. I can sing every song when I listen to yacht rock. I’m a sucker for it. Hence, why I’m a crier.

Watch the 2023 Streamy Awards Here

The 2023 Streamy Awards have arrived, bringing together today’s biggest creators to celebrate content across beauty, comedy, food, gaming, music, podcasts and sports.

The jam-packed event, hosted by MatPat, will feature presenters Anna Sitar, Brianna Chickenfry, Chris Olsen, Colin and Samir, Delaney Rowe, Dream, Drew Afualo, Druski, Dylan Mulvaney, Happy Kelli, Jay Shetty, Kris Collins, Lizzy McAlpine, Michelle Khare, Pinkydoll, Rhett & Link, Ryan Trahan, Smosh, Supercar Blondie, Tana Mongeau, WWE stars Austin Creed and Zelina Vega, and xQc. Additionally, RuPaul’s Drag Race alum Shea Couleé will be appearing throughout the show to interact with creators in the audience.

Armani White is also set to take the stage to deliver a medley of his viral Billboard Hot 100 hit “Billie Eilish” as well as “Silver Tooth,” before Icona Pop perform their new single “Fall in Love” along with “I Love It,” their 2013 Hot 100 top 10 hit with Charli XCX.

Mr. Beast leads this year’s nominations with five nods (see the full list of nominations here). Nominees for the first-ever Rolling Stone Sound of the Year Award — honoring the year’s most impactful songs that have dominated content creation on social media and in popular culture — include Big Boss Vette, Doechii, d4vd, Coi Leray, Ice Spice, Kaliii, Sam Smith with Kim Petras, PinkPantheress, Meghan Trainor, and Armani White.
